Findings by severity

Florida sorts every inspection deficiency into a severity class, Class I being the most serious. These counts cover the state's current review period.

2
Class II
Direct threat to resident health, safety or security
18
Class III
Indirect threat to resident health, safety or security
1
Class IV
Minor issue, usually paperwork or posting requirements
1
Unclassified
Severity not classified in the state record
